What role does hydration play in skin care?

Asked by Ilana

What role does hydration play in skin care? How does that affect different skin types and conditions?

Ilana answered
    Dr. Schultz 1.86K Rep.

    Hydration is “automatic” in healthy and oil/water balance skin and then needs no help. When water glands are underactive (for reasons we don’t understand but NOT because you don’t drink enough fluids), the skin becomes dry and needs supplemental moisture best supplied by water based moisturizers. This water deficient skin occurs in people whose water/oil skin types are dry, combination or mature. But internal hydration, i.e., drinking fluids, plays no role here.
